a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orChris Mason <clm@fb.com>2023-04-17 00:12:18 -0700
committerChris Mason <clm@fb.com>2023-04-17 00:12:18 -0700
commitab22f3f8766e1bf8a3e8f481c205c8f153dd200d (patch)
tree0c21474b1e028fd671741c4e66d878ca80be572b
parentd22e8e8a0c9fcd313229f5a9305436d13157844f (diff)
downloadschbench-ab22f3f8766e1bf8a3e8f481c205c8f153dd200d.tar.gz
schbench: consistently use stderr for metric outputv1.0
Signed-off-by: Chris Mason <clm@fb.com>
-rw-r--r--schbench.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/schbench.c b/schbench.c
index 563eb8e..2ff1764 100644
--- a/schbench.c
+++ b/schbench.c
@@ -1283,7 +1283,7 @@ static void sleep_for_runtime(struct thread_data *message_threads_mem)
"requests", runtime_delta / USEC_PER_SEC,
PLIST_FOR_RPS, PLIST_50);
}
- fprintf(stdout, "current rps: %.2f\n", rps);
+ fprintf(stderr, "current rps: %.2f\n", rps);
total_intervals++;
}
}
@@ -1399,7 +1399,7 @@ int main(int ac, char **av)
mb_per_sec = (loop_count * pipe_test * USEC_PER_SEC) / loop_runtime;
mb_per_sec = pretty_size(mb_per_sec, &pretty);
- printf("avg worker transfer: %.2f ops/sec %.2f%s/s\n",
+ fprintf(stderr, "avg worker transfer: %.2f ops/sec %.2f%s/s\n",
loops_per_sec, mb_per_sec, pretty);
} else {
show_latencies(&wakeup_stats, "Wakeup Latencies", "usec", runtime,
@@ -1409,7 +1409,7 @@ int main(int ac, char **av)
show_latencies(&rps_stats, "RPS", "requests", runtime,
PLIST_FOR_RPS, PLIST_50);
if (!auto_rps)
- fprintf(stdout, "average rps: %.2f\n",
+ fprintf(stderr, "average rps: %.2f\n",
(double)(loop_count) / runtime);
}